// See the InsecureSkipVerify and OriginPatterns options to allow cross origin requests.
//
// Accept will write a response to w on all errors.
//
// Note that using the http.Request Context after Accept returns may lead to
// unexpected behavior (see http.Hijacker).
func Accept(w http.ResponseWriter, r *http.Request, opts *AcceptOptions) (*Conn, error) {
